  • Patent number: 5301302
    Abstract: The system and method of this invention simulates the flow of control of an application program targeted for a specific instruction set of a specific processor by utilizing a simulator running on a second processing system having a second processor with a different instruction set. The simulator reduces the number of translated instructions needed to simulate the flow of control of the first processor instructions by detecting, at the time of a store to memory, whether an instruction, data, or video is being updated. If the memory location that is being updated contains an instruction, the simulator takes additional steps to guarantee the correct execution of the modified instruction. If the simulator determines at the time of a store that the memory location being modified is data, the simulator needs to take no additional steps.

  • Patent number: 4787026
    Abstract: A method to manage the operation of a coprocessor in a virtual memory type data processing system in which an Input/Output channel and an Input/output channel controller interconnect the coprocessor to the main processor and system memory. A Virtual Resource Manager (VRM) comprising a group of interrelated software programs function in the system to establish virtual machines that execute application programs concurrently. A Coprocessor Manager component of the VRM establishes a Virtual Machine in which the compressor executes application programs that cannot be executed on the main processor. The coprocessor is mounted on an integrated circuit card which is inserted into a `mother board` socket which contains the main processor and related components.
